Understanding Spoke Basket Weaving

Spoke basket weaving involves creating a sturdy framework of spokes, typically made from strong and flexible materials like reed or willow. These spokes radiate outwards from the base, forming the skeleton of the basket. Around these spokes, weavers interlace thinner, more pliable materials called weavers to create the basket’s body and shape. Choosing the Right Materials

Selecting the right materials is the first step in weaving a successful spoke basket. While reed and willow are common choices, you can experiment with other natural materials like oak, ash, or even bamboo. The key is to choose materials that are strong enough to form the spokes yet flexible enough to bend and shape without breaking. The thickness and width of your chosen spokes will also impact the final appearance of your basket. Do you prefer a fine, delicate basket or a more rustic, robust design? These considerations will influence your material choices.

Preparing the Spokes and Weavers

Before you begin weaving, you’ll need to prepare both the spokes and weavers. Soaking the spokes in water makes them pliable and easier to work with. The soaking time varies depending on the material and its thickness. Over-soaking can weaken the spokes, so it’s essential to follow recommended guidelines. Similarly, weavers should be dampened slightly to improve their flexibility and prevent them from snapping during the weaving process. Starting the Base

The base of the spoke basket is the foundation upon which the rest of the structure is built. Typically, the spokes are arranged in a radiating pattern, often in multiples of four or six. They are then secured using various techniques, such as lashing or twining, to create a stable center. The chosen technique often depends on the material and the desired aesthetic of the basket.

Weaving the Basket

Once the base is secured, the actual weaving begins. The weavers are carefully interwoven around the spokes, gradually building up the sides of the basket. From simple twining to more complex waling or pairing, the choice of technique will influence the final look and feel of your basket. As you weave, you’ll shape the basket by adjusting the tension and angle of the weavers.

Finishing the Rim

The rim of the spoke basket provides both structural integrity and a finished look. There are various techniques for finishing the rim, from simple bending and tucking to more intricate braiding or lashing.
